Adam Kimelman: Carolina Hurricanes defenseman Jalen Chatfield returned to the lineup after missing the past two games with a lower-body injury.

Eric Francis: Colorado Avalanche forward Nazem Kadri is travelling with the team, but won’t play against the Flames tonight.

Gerry Moddejonge: Avalanche defenseman Josh Manson missed last night’s game after leaving Saturday’s game with an upper-body injury.

Robert Tiffin: The Dallas Stars activated forward Radek Faksa from the IR.

Ryan Rishaug: Edmonton Oilers coach said Kris Knoblauch said that forward Zach Hyman wasn’t able to go last night, but he might be ready for Thursday. Forward Leon Draisaitl is expected to be ready to return sometime in round one. Forward Max Jones is out for three to four weeks. Forward Jason Dickinson won’t play in their last regular season and he’ll be re-evaluated then.

Mark Spector of Sportsnet: Edmonton Oilers forward Leon Draisaitl (knee) likely isn’t going to be ready for Game 1 of the Stanley Cup playoffs, but he may not be far off that.

“We’ll see,” the coy German said on Monday morning. “There are steps I have to follow and certain things I have to be able to do. I’m not there yet right now. We’ll see how that is by the end of the week or whenever Game 1 would be.”

Coach Knoblauch said that ideally, after some more skates and rehabs, he’d be ready for Game 1, but if it’s not until later, they’ll just deal with it.

Zach Dooley: Los Angeles Kings forward Jeff Malott will miss their remaining regular-season games. Forward Alex Turcotte is getting “real close” to returning, according to coach D.J. Smith.

Robby Stanley: Nashville Predators defenseman Nicolas Hague missed his fifth consecutive game with an upper-body injury.

Bruce Garrioch of the Ottawa Citizen: Ottawa Senators forward Brady Tkachuk will likely miss their remaining regular-season games, but is expected to be ready for the start of the playoffs. He left Saturday’s game as he “wasn’t feeling well.” A source said that whatever it is, it isn’t deemed serious.

Seattle Kraken PR: Forward Jared McCann will miss the remainder of the season with a lower-body injury.

NHL: Tampa Bay Lightning forward Brandon Hagel and defenseman Darren Raddysh missed last night’s game with undisclosed injuries. Hagel returned on Saturday from a lower-body injury.

Winnipeg Jets PR: The Winnipeg Jets activated defenseman Colin Miller from the IR.

Mitchell Clinton: Jets coach Scott Arniel on forwards Alex Iafallo and Vladislav Namestnikov, and defenseman Neal Pionk:

“All three of those guys, a couple of them were banged up two games ago. Last game, Vladdy was the one that got hurt. They were playing with some injuries and were trying to get through it. We’re at a stage right now where, it’s not because of where we’re at and lost the other night, these guys have been trying to put everything on the line to play. Right not, they’re not even at 50 or 60 percent. That’s why we had to make a move and bring in some other guys, some fresh legs, and hopefully that gives us  little bit of a spark.”
